What Boris is

Boris compiles a directory of Markdown pages into a static HTML site, a JSON IR, optional RAG packs, an llms.txt, RSS, and a sitemap. It also speaks publication plans for GitHub Pages, Standard.site / ATProto, and Nostr (NIP-23). This repo uses the HTML path only.

It is not a generic static-site generator in the Jekyll sense. Pages form a graph. parent: is a real edge. [[wiki-links]] are real edges. A link to a missing page fails the build (exit 1), it does not render as a dead <a>.

Bare ./boris with no flags builds HTML under dist/ as target default. This repo always passes --input, --html-dir, and --theme so the command is obvious.

Exit codes: 0 success, 1 content validation, 2 usage, 3 I/O or system.

Frontmatter

One Markdown file is one page. Flat YAML only: no nested maps, no sequences except tags and relations. Supported keys:

Key Role
title Page title, {{title}}, search
id Override the path-derived entity id
parent Structural parent entity id
tags [a, b]
relations [relates_to=other-id] (and the other relation verbs the compiler allows)
summary Short description
status Publication status
published_at Date string

Entity ids that differ only by case collide. parent must point at a real page and must not cycle. The trunk (index) has no parent.

There is no layout frontmatter. Layout is selected by --theme, --html-layout, or --layout-rule (id:, glob:, role:trunk|satellite).

Layout slots

themes/boris/layouts/main.html is the only layout. Keep exactly one of each referenced slot.

Slot Purpose
{{head}} Compiler-owned head extras (required if you ever verify / Nostr / Standard.site)
{{content}} Rendered page (required)
{{title}} Frontmatter title
{{nav}} Graph forest
{{breadcrumb}} Parent chain
{{toc}} In-page headings
{{footer}} Compiler footer
{{asset-url assets/css/boris.css}} Theme file under themes/boris/

If the build fails

  1. Read the error. Validation problems are almost always a missing wiki-link target, a bad parent, duplicate id, or illegal frontmatter.
  2. Run ./boris validate --input content --theme themes/boris.
  3. Run ./boris check --input content for graph hygiene.
  4. Staging lives in dist.boris-stage and is committed only on full success. Leave it alone.

A successful HTML build writes dist/**/*.html plus copied assets. Incremental / watch also write dist/.boris-cache/manifest.json.
